CHRIS SOULES BEGINS HIS SEARCH FOR THAT ONE SPECIAL WOMAN WHEN "THE BACHELOR" PREMIERES, MONDAY, JANUARY 5 ON ABC

A Record 30 Bachelorettes Who Look to Capture the Sexy, Wealthy "Prince Farmer's" Heart Are Revealed

What do a dedicated school guidance counselor, a raven-haired beauty with a rebellious past, a self-proclaimed virgin with a healthy libido, a stunning petite beauty who is searching for her soul mate and a spunky Southern belle, who is a fertility specialist yearning to fall in love and have her own children, all have in common? They all have their sights set on moving to Arlington, Iowa, with the Bachelor, Chris Soules, when the 19th edition of ABC's popular romance reality series, "The Bachelor," premieres with a live event for the first time ever, MONDAY, JANUARY 5 (8:00-11:00 p.m., ET), on the ABC Television Network.

Chris Soules, 33, a handsome, successful farmer from Arlington, Iowa, meets 30 potential soul mates as he begins his exciting search for true love. In the premiere, "Episode 1901," Chris prepares for the night of his life as the 30 beautiful bachelorettes, all clamoring to meet him, begin to arrive. Britt rocks Chris' world with a memorable bear hug. Not to be outdone, Tara arrives wearing "Daisy Dukes" and cowboy boots. Amanda blindfolds the object of her affection and slips into the party before Chris can see her. Reegan, the cadaver tissue saleswoman, brings the Bachelor a heartfelt surprise in a medical cooler. And six-foot blonde stunner, Tandra, roars up on a motorcycle in a gorgeous evening gown and biker boots.

After only 15 bachelorettes arrive, the party surprisingly starts, and the "hugger" Britt makes the most of her opportunity as she and Chris have undeniable chemistry and get close very quickly. Whitney, the vivacious fertility nurse, coyly explains to the Bachelor that she makes babies for a living. After Chris Harrison brings out the first impression rose, the fun really starts as another 15 bachelorettes are about to join the party. Mackenzie, a young mom invites Chris to share an activity that is close to his heart, and Kaitlyn teaches our Bachelor how to breakdance. However, Ashley S. feels the pressure and her nerves get the better of her. Chris makes his first decision of the night, offering the first impression rose to a very surprised woman. Finally, after his first rose ceremony, 22 women will remain to compete for Chris' affection and, in the end, his heart. But one woman has something else on her mind and takes matters into her own hands, turning Chris' perfect world upside down. What should have been the start of his romantic journey now becomes one of the most dramatic twists in Bachelor history.
